vue可以擦什么火花

fiy 其他 13

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Vue可以擦出以下几个火花:

    1. 简单易用:Vue提供了直观的语法和灵活的API,使得项目开发变得简单易用。Vue的核心是一个轻量级的前端框架,可以帮助开发者快速构建用户界面。

    2. 响应式数据绑定:Vue的核心概念是响应式数据绑定,通过使用指令和模板语法,开发者可以轻松地将数据和DOM元素进行绑定。当数据发生变化时,Vue会自动更新视图,使开发者无需手动操作DOM。

    3. 组件化开发:Vue支持组件化开发,可以将页面拆分成独立的组件,每个组件都有自己的模板、样式和逻辑。这使得项目的管理和维护变得更加简单,同时也提高了代码的复用性。

    4. 虚拟DOM:Vue使用虚拟DOM来优化页面的渲染性能。当数据发生变化时,Vue会先生成一个虚拟DOM树,然后通过比较前后两个虚拟DOM树的差异,最终只更新需要改变的部分,避免了全量更新DOM的开销。

    5. 全面的生态系统:Vue不仅仅是一个前端框架,它还有众多的配套工具和插件,如Vue Router用于处理路由,Vuex用于状态管理,Vue CLI用于项目脚手架的搭建等。这些工具和插件可以帮助开发者更高效地开发和管理项目。

    综上所述,Vue提供了简单易用、响应式数据绑定、组件化开发、虚拟DOM和全面的生态系统等特点,使其能够擦出火花,让前端开发变得更加高效和愉快。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Vue可以擦出以下火花:

    1. 前端开发的简易性:Vue是一款轻量级的JavaScript框架,它提供了简单易学的API和丰富的生态系统,使得前端开发变得异常简单。Vue使用了模块化的开发方式,可以根据需求选择性地引入和组合各种组件和插件,提高开发效率。
    2. 响应式的数据绑定:Vue采用了基于数据的双向绑定机制,可以实现数据和视图的实时同步。通过Vue的指令和模板语法,我们可以简洁地定义数据绑定,并可以在数据变化时自动更新视图。这种响应式的数据绑定使得开发者可以专注于业务逻辑而无需手动操作DOM。
    3. 组件化的开发方式:Vue将页面抽象为一个个组件,一个组件包含了HTML、CSS和JavaScript的代码。组件化开发使得代码具有良好的可重用性,可以将复杂的UI和交互逻辑拆分为多个组件,每个组件负责自己的功能。组件之间可以通过props和events的方式进行通信,使得代码更加清晰、可维护和可测试。
    4. 良好的生态系统:Vue拥有庞大而活跃的社区,在社区中存在着大量的开源组件和工具,可以帮助开发者快速构建复杂的应用。例如,Vuex用于状态管理、Vue Router用于路由管理、Vue CLI用于项目脚手架等等。这些组件和工具的存在,使得开发者可以快速解决自己遇到的问题,并提高开发效率。
    5. 优秀的性能表现:Vue具有良好的性能表现,在页面加载时只渲染可见区域,减少不必要的DOM操作。同时,Vue通过虚拟DOM技术优化了DOM操作的效率,只对有变化的部分进行更新。这种优化使得Vue在处理大规模数据和复杂交互的场景下,依然具有出色的性能表现。
      总的来说,Vue的火花主要来自于它的简易性、响应式的数据绑定、组件化的开发方式、丰富的生态系统和良好的性能表现,这些特点使得Vue成为当今Web前端开发中备受推崇的框架之一。
    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Vue(读音为/view)是一个用于构建用户界面的开源JavaScript框架。它采用了MVVM(模型 – 视图 – 视图模型)设计模式,将应用程序的数据模型,视图和用户交互逻辑进行了解耦,使开发更加高效、灵活和可维护。

    Vue框架有很多令人兴奋的功能和特点,使它成为许多开发人员的首选框架之一。下面就让我们来看看Vue框架可以擦出什么火花吧。

    1. 响应式数据绑定:Vue采用了双向绑定的机制,使得数据的变化能够自动反映在视图上,而视图的变化也能够自动更新到数据模型中。这种响应式的数据绑定机制大大简化了开发的复杂度,使得开发人员可以更专注于业务逻辑的处理,而不必手动更新视图。

    2. 组件化开发:Vue框架将用户界面划分为许多独立的组件,每个组件都有自己的逻辑和样式。这种组件化的开发模式使得界面可以被复用,减少了代码的冗余程度,提高了开发效率。同时,组件之间的通信也变得简单和高效。

    3. 虚拟DOM:Vue使用虚拟DOM技术来提高渲染性能。虚拟DOM是一个轻量级的JavaScript对象,它对应着真实的DOM节点树。当数据发生变化时,Vue会计算出新的虚拟DOM树,并与旧的虚拟DOM树进行对比,找出发生变化的部分,并只更新这部分变化的内容。这种优化机制减少了对真实DOM的操作次数,提高了渲染性能。

    4. 组合式API:Vue 3引入了组合式API,以解决在组件逻辑复用和代码组织方面的问题。组合式API允许开发人员根据不同的逻辑将相关代码封装为自定义的hook函数,使得代码结构更加清晰和可维护。

    5. 插件生态系统:Vue拥有庞大的插件生态系统,开发人员可以通过插件扩展Vue的功能。这些插件包括表单验证、路由管理、状态管理等,可以大大简化开发过程。

    6. 社区支持:Vue拥有一个庞大的社区,在社区中可以找到许多优秀的开源项目、教程和资源。这些资源可以帮助开发人员快速入门,并提供解决问题的方法和思路。

    总结起来,Vue框架通过响应式数据绑定、组件化开发、虚拟DOM等技术,使得开发人员能够高效、灵活地构建用户界面。它的使用广泛和强大的功能使得Vue成为了人们追求火花的选择。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部